Geekbench 5 Benchmarks
AMD Ryzen 3 1200 | vs | Intel Core i9-14900F |
---|---|---|
Jul 27th, 2017 | Release Date | Jan 8th, 2024 |
Ryzen 3 | Collection | Core i9 |
Summit Ridge | Codename | Raptor Lake |
AMD Socket AM4 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
4 | Cores | 24 |
4 | Threads | 32 |
3.1 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.0 GHz |
3.4 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 5.8 GHz |
65 W | TDP | Not Available |
14 nm | Process Size | 10 nm |
31.0x | Multiplier | 20.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| None |
Yes | Overclockable | No |
